Moneybookers.com offers Internet users the
opportunity to send money to any email address and to securely pay in
Internet shops without having to enter credit card details there.
Moneybookers.com is therefore an ideal service for webshops, auctions and
private people who want to send or receive money quickly and securely.
In February 2003, Moneybookers.com became the first regulated e-money issuer
in the world. The association is already a leading Internet payment service
provider for micro payments in Europe. Moneybookers.com is licensed
by the Financial Services Authority [FSA] under the licence number 214225
and is a member of the Electronic Money Association
[EMA].
